Notes
Caption title.
Bound in v. 1 (PML 145499) as plate 100, of an extra-illustrated copy of The Holy Bible, Oxford : Clarendon Press, 1814-1815 (see Harris Bible PML 145499-06).
Print inlaid in leaf measuring 331 x 233 mm, bound into volume.
Print engraved by Duparc after painting by Patel, published as plate 719 in v. 10 of "Galerie du Musée Napoléon" (Paris : Filhol, 1804-1828).
Lettered at head: Patel Père; numbered at upper left: No. 719; lettered at upper right Ecole Flamde; at lower left: Desiné par Vaserot; at lower center: Gravé à l' Eau-forte par Pillment; lower right: Temé par Duparc.

Description
1 print : engraving ; image: 126 x 109 mm; sheet: 147 x 116 mm
Provenance
From the library of Gordon N. Ray.
Summary
Oval design shows Jochebed placing the basket in the river, beyond at center Miriam walks towards her, and at left stand the ruins of a classical building.
